Launched in September 2007, Barrio North is a neighbourhood DJ bar that combines the spirit of community and collaboration with street culture from the 'ghetto archipelago'. Taking in the vibe from London to New York, Miami to Mexico, Rio to Havana, Lisbon to Barcelona and any other city where music, art and culture collide and meld in their own unique way.
Taking in the culture, sounds and tastes along the way with a good measure of Latin spirit, Barrio North’s neighbourhood is inclusive of anyone with a similar mind set rather than geographic locality. A love of music in all its worldly genres, an appreciation of up and coming musicians, artists and urban poets, combined with an appetite for drinks sourced from all corners and served how they should be – you’re in Barrio’s ‘hood!
Made in São Paulo - Debut album of brilliant Brazilian singer/Songwriter Tupiniquin_ feat - TITA LIMA, COMADRE_BLUR_ plus other artists featured on Brazil's most innovative exports such as Cêu. Tupiniquin; from the English Oxford dictionary means simply: a Brazilian. Made in São Paulo dares sharing a diverse array of sounds out of the largest urban culture in the southern hemisphere. In it, just like in São Paulo itself one will hear rock, afro-samba canção, bossa beats and the sounds of “Tropicália”. Like different races and tastes, colours and textures in his city, Tupiniquin portrait the universal appeal of Brazil via live arrangements carrying strong synergy with pop music from England & USA today, combine with a unique, mature songwriter statements on contemporary Brazil; or shall we say – São Paulo!
